Tour Search widget

The Tour Search Widget allows visitors to quickly search and filter trips on your travel website. To use this widget, you must first install and activate the WP Travel Engine – Elementor Widgets plugin.

Once the plugin is activated, you can add and customize the Tour Search Widget using the Elementor page builder.

Follow the instructions below to configure the settings: #

These options allow you to choose which taxonomies (filters) you want to display in the Trip Search Widget. Taxonomies help users filter trips based on different criteria.

  • Select Taxonomy: This option lets you choose which filters (taxonomies) you want to display in the search widget. Taxonomies help users narrow down trips based on specific criteria.
    • You can choose from:
      • Destination
      • Activities
      • Trip Types
  • Show Terms By: This setting controls how the terms inside each taxonomy are displayed.
    • Default: Automatically shows all terms from the selected taxonomy.
    • Choose From the List: Allows you to manually select specific terms that should appear in the filter.

Additional Settings #

These settings give you extra customization options for the search widget.

  • Show Category: Enable or disable the category filter in the search widget.
  • Button Text: Set the label/text that appears on the search button.
  • Button Link: Add a custom URL if you want the search button to redirect users to a specific page.
  • Button Icon: Add an icon to the button. You can upload an SVG file or choose an icon from the icon library to match your design.
